13352417641299945709739494200615763968094
Even
13352417641299945709739494200615763968094 is even
Previous even number is 13352417641299945709739494200615763968092
Next even number is 13352417641299945709739494200615763968096
Cubed
2380563243335697491554196383977202961996290062313070392813815911349583814522278239325970836394688889876009861520032574584
Squared
178287056867698005653225743186229368646697992285225564183620161374002868649992836
Binary
10011100111101001111100001100010110110011110100110011000001100110000011001101011011110110011000001101111000110001100000000000001011110